After more than 30 years, the ferry connection between the Italian city of Trieste and Croatia will be re-established. Four holiday ferry lines will be operated by the Italian ferry line Liberty Lines.
On 26 June, the first ferry service between Trieste and the Croatian Istrian ports since the early 1990s will set sail on the Adriatic. The new attraction for tourists and locals could become a holiday hit. The new ferry service is being launched by the Italian ferry operator Liberty Lines. From 26 June to 1 September, passengers will be able to travel from Trieste to the Croatian cities of Poreč and Rovinj and to the Slovenian city of Piran. There will be a total of four routes, which are as follows:
The connection will be available six times a week, except on Tuesdays, and the ferries will take up to 180 passengers on board. Ticket prices are not yet known as they have not been added to the booking system yet.
